На главную Наши проекты:
Журнал   ·   Discuz!ML   ·   Wiki   ·   DRKB   ·   Помощь проекту
ПРАВИЛА FAQ Помощь Участники Календарь Избранное RSS
msm.ru
! информация о разделе
user posted imageДанный раздел предназначается для обсуждения вопросов использования баз данных, за исключением составления запросов на SQL. Для этого выделен специальный раздел. Убедительная просьба - соблюдать "Правила форума" и не пренебрегать "Правильным оформлением своих тем". Прежде, чем создавать тему, имеет смысл заглянуть в раздел "Базы данных: FAQ", возможно там уже есть ответ.

Модераторы: Chow, Bas, MIF
Страницы: (2) [1] 2  все  ( Перейти к последнему сообщению )  
> Малое предприятие , какую БД выбрать
    Подскажите, в каком направлении лучше двинуться. Есть маленькое предприятие (несколько компов в локальной сети и несколько удаленно через VPN) Акцесовская база, с которой работаю из VB6. Пока было всё по локалке, было всё хорошо, а вот удаленно "шуршит" - очень медленно. Посоветуйте, какая СУБД в данной ситуации будет работать быстро и насколько быстро?

    Эта тема была разделена из темы "Какую базу данных выбрать?"
      Цитата Yurii @
      Пока было всё по локалке, было всё хорошо, а вот удаленно "шуршит" - очень медленно.

      Все будет медленно.
        Yurii, MSSQL. Есть бесплатная редакция, Express (с ограничениями) и настоятельно советуют переходить на нее.
          SQL Server Express тебе подойдёт. "Портировать" удастся одной кнопкой (ну почти). После портирования у тебя в Access останутся свзяанные по ODBC таблицы с сервером - т.е. можно будет переписывать куски не теряя работоспособности. От DAO придётся постепенно уйти (если им пользуешься) и перейти на ADO. В перспективе нужно закладываться на избавление от ODBC-ссылок, потому что чем дальше в лес, тем толще будут партизаны, т.е. рассматривай это как временной решение.
            Цитата
            Ограничения

            1 поддерживаемый процессор (но может быть установлен на любой сервер)
            1 Гб адресуемой памяти
            4 Гб максимальный размер базы (10 Гб для версии SQL Server 2008 R2)
            Через интерфейс SQL Server Management Studio 2005 нет возможности экспорта/импорта данных (в версии 2008 эта возможность присутствует)
              Koss, эти ограничения в сравнении с ограничениями Access'а - просто сказка :).
                Цитата Yurii @
                Подскажите, в каком направлении лучше двинуться. Есть маленькое предприятие (несколько компов в локальной сети и несколько удаленно через VPN) Акцесовская база, с которой работаю из VB6. Пока было всё по локалке, было всё хорошо, а вот удаленно "шуршит" - очень медленно. Посоветуйте, какая СУБД в данной ситуации будет работать быстро и насколько быстро?


                А через удаленный рабочий стол подключаться к компу, на котором база не вариант ?

                Добавлено
                Цитата Koss @
                4 Гб максимальный размер базы

                Это только даныне пользователя ? Или индексы тоже сюда входят ?
                  Цитата Marriage @
                  А через удаленный рабочий стол подключаться к компу, на котором база не вариант ?

                  Хороший вариант, кстати :yes:

                  Цитата Marriage @
                  Это только даныне пользователя ? Или индексы тоже сюда входят ?

                  Индексы тоже.
                    Цитата archimed7592 @
                    Индексы тоже.

                    ТОгда нафиг... Через год-полтора перевалить должна за 4 Гб ...
                    Лучше коннект через удаленку или тот-же radmin, teamviewver ... И переделывать ничего не надо...
                    Сообщение отредактировано: Marriage -
                      Кто что скажет про постгресс ?
                        Цитата Yurii @
                        Подскажите, в каком направлении лучше двинуться. Есть маленькое предприятие (несколько компов в локальной сети и несколько удаленно через VPN) Акцесовская база, с которой работаю из VB6. Пока было всё по локалке, было всё хорошо, а вот удаленно "шуршит" - очень медленно. Посоветуйте, какая СУБД в данной ситуации будет работать быстро и насколько быстро?

                        Сугубо по моему мнению влияют, в первую очередь, объём передаваемых данных и пропускная способность канала. Во вторую - кол-во одновременных пользователей и интенсивность работы БД. Может Access даже не виноват.
                          и использовать правильно.
                          Цитата Yurii @
                          Посоветуйте, какая СУБД в данной ситуации будет работать быстро и насколько быстро?

                          В этом случае надо
                          1 использовать SQL
                          2 и использовать правильно.
                          Программа не должна прогонять по сетке всю таблицу, Вместо этого надо выдать запрос и получить искомое значение.
                            Цитата Yurii @
                            Посоветуйте, какая СУБД в данной ситуации будет работать быстро и насколько быстро?

                            Считаю, что надобность в работе удалённых пользователей диктует необходимость перехода либо на терминальные решения, либо на решения типа (вебсервер-скрипт-СУБД) - наппример классическая денвероподобная связка (НО НЕ ДЕНВЕР!!!). Последнее - наиболее дешёвый и вовсе не трудный в реализации вариант.
                              А MySql разве не бесплатен?
                                бесплатен... и что?
                                0 пользователей читают эту тему (0 гостей и 0 скрытых пользователей)
                                0 пользователей:


                                Рейтинг@Mail.ru
                                [ Script execution time: 0,0419 ]   [ 15 queries used ]   [ Generated: 25.04.24, 04:41 GMT ]